Transaction 071121cd828af9a10bb05d28f090a8ea637970045ce1f20caec3f49efedef6e7

1 Input
2 Outputs
  • 071121cd828af9a10bb05d28f090a8ea637970045ce1f20caec3f49efedef6e7:0
  • value  13400000
    address  1LsPbpv9fghJihDqYiHxixvtbiFmxa8dvb
  • 071121cd828af9a10bb05d28f090a8ea637970045ce1f20caec3f49efedef6e7:1
  • value  15727514
    address  32psLxh12trmK67XwDoXuAV4YpNsNdJFXr